
Source: Storj
Storj is a decentralized cloud storage platform that uses blockchain technology to provide secure, affordable, and scalable storage solutions. Storj’s decentralized architecture allows for faster access times and greater security than traditional cloud storage options. In this section, we will explore Storj in more detail and compare it to traditional storage options.
Storj is built on a peer-to-peer network of storage nodes that work together to store and retrieve data. Unlike traditional cloud storage options, where data is stored in a central location, Storj distributes data across multiple nodes, making it more secure and resistant to data breaches. This distributed architecture also means that Storj can offer better performance and faster access times, as data is retrieved from the node closest to the user.
Storj utilizes an advanced data storage and retrieval technique known as erasure coding. With erasure coding, data is distributed across multiple nodes, ensuring redundancy and improving data availability. Each node stores a small piece of the data, and when a user requests access, Storj retrieves and reconstructs the data from multiple nodes. This approach enhances the overall reliability and resilience of the storage network, ensuring that data remains accessible even if some nodes become unavailable.
Storj leverages the inherent security of blockchain technology to safeguard the network and ensure the integrity of stored data. Through robust data encryption techniques and decentralized key management, Storj ensures that data remains confidential and tamper-proof. By leveraging the transparency and immutability of the blockchain, Storj creates an auditable record of data transactions, enhancing the overall security and trustworthiness of the platform.
In terms of cost, Storj is more affordable than traditional cloud storage options. Because Storj uses a distributed network of nodes, it can offer storage at a lower cost than centralized providers. Additionally, Storj has a unique pricing model that rewards node operators for providing storage and bandwidth to the network. This means that users can get even lower prices by participating in the Storj network as a node operator.
One potential drawback of Storj is that it requires users to have some technical knowledge to set up and use the service. Unlike traditional cloud storage providers, which offer user-friendly interfaces and simple setup processes, Storj requires users to interact with command-line tools and configure their own storage nodes. This can be a barrier for some users, especially those who are not comfortable with technology.
Highlights